How Real-World Factors Shape Deliverability
Mail servers don’t treat every message the same. They check SPF, DKIM, and DMARC records to confirm your domain’s legitimacy. If any of these are missing or misconfigured, the email may be rejected before it even arrives. These are not optional — they’re standard requirements enforced by major providers. You can check your setup using tools like MXToolbox, but testing in real mail environments gives you more accurate results than diagnostic tools alone.
Sender reputation matters too. If your IP or domain has a history of sending spam or has high bounce rates, mail servers may block your messages even if they’re technically sound. This is why testing before large sends is essential—especially for procurement teams who need timely, accurate updates.

Why an Individual Bad Address Matters More Than You Think
Procurement systems often use strict filtering rules that react to poor list hygiene. A single invalid address might not send itself, but if it’s a trap email (a honeypot used by spam filters), or a catch-all inbox (where all emails are accepted), it can signal spammy behavior to enterprise security tools.
When a bulk sender includes such addresses, especially at scale, the bounce rate spikes. Mail servers track sender reputation through aggregate metrics. High bounce rates—especially from non-deliverable or role-based addresses (like [email protected])—are red flags. Many organizations use third-party tools like Spamhaus or MxToolbox to block senders with a history of poor hygiene.

Why You Shouldn’t Rely on Your ESP’s Built-in Deliverability Checks
Most email platforms check only syntax and basic DNS records—they don’t simulate how your message lands in real inboxes, especially with procurement teams who use strict filters. You’re guessing whether your message reaches the inbox, not knowing if sender reputation, greylisting, or domain-specific rules block it. A real inbox test is the only way to know. SMTP standards define delivery, but they don’t cover inbox placement.
What Your ESP Actually Tests
When you send a campaign through Mailchimp or SendGrid, it runs a quick syntax check and confirms MX records are set. That’s all. It doesn’t check if your domain is on a blocklist, whether your sender IP has a poor track record, or if your message gets flagged by a recipient’s rules engine. These are the real hurdles—not formatting.
Let’s be honest: if your ESP doesn’t show you where your email lands, you’re blind. Many logistics procurement teams use enterprise email systems (Microsoft 365, Google Workspace) with aggressive filtering. A message might pass validation but still be quarantined or routed to junk folders. You won’t know unless you test inside a real inbox.
Real Inbox Placement Needs Real Testing
Greylisting, for example, delays delivery until the sender retries—common with servers that don’t follow strict SMTP timing. Your ESP won’t tell you this happens. Neither will it test how your message performs across multiple domains used by procurement teams (e.g., @logisticscorp.com, @supplychain.net), or whether your email looks suspicious due to low sender reputation.
If your email never lands in the inbox, even a well-written message is useless. You can’t rely on an ESP that only checks for “valid syntax” and “DNS records.” That’s not deliverability—it’s a basic filter.

Remove High-Risk Addresses Before Sending
- Eliminate catch-all domains (where any email is accepted) as they don’t confirm real inbox ownership. These often appear in scraped or public data.
- Remove role-based emails like
procurement@,orders@, orinfo@. They are commonly used for bulk distribution but not for individual response. - Block disposable domains (like
temp-mail.orgor10minutemail.com). They’re used for fake sign-ups, not real communication. You can find current lists of these at Spamhaus ZEN. - Don’t trust leads from unstructured sources—public directories, forums, or third-party lead marketplaces—without verification. They often contain outdated or inaccurate data.
